//! Common parsing utilities for derive macros.
|
|
//!
|
|
//! Fair parsing of [`syn::Expr`] requires [`syn`]'s `full` feature to be enabled, which unnecessary
|
|
//! increases compile times. As we don't have complex AST manipulation, usually requiring only
|
|
//! understanding where syntax item begins and ends, simpler manual parsing is implemented.
|
|
|
|
use proc_macro2::{Spacing, TokenStream};
|
|
use quote::ToTokens;
|
|
use syn::{
|
|
buffer::Cursor,
|
|
parse::{Parse, ParseStream},
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
/// [`syn::Expr`] [`Parse`]ing polyfill.
|
|
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
|
|
pub(crate) enum Expr {
|
|
/// [`syn::Expr::Path`] of length 1 [`Parse`]ing polyfill.
|
|
Ident(syn::Ident),
|
|
|
|
/// Every other [`syn::Expr`] variant.
|
|
Other(TokenStream),
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l Expr {
|
|
/// Returns a [`syn::Ident`] in case this [`Expr`] is represented only by it.
|
|
///
|
|
/// [`syn::Ident`]: struct@syn::Ident
|
|
pub(crate) fn ident(&self) -> Option<&syn::Ident> {
|
|
match self {
|
|
Self::Ident(ident) => Some(ident),
|
|
Self::Other(_) => None,
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l From<syn::Ident> for Expr {
|
|
fn from(ident: syn::Ident) -> Self {
|
|
Self::Ident(ident)
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l Parse for Expr {
|
|
fn parse(input: ParseStream) -> syn::Result<Self> {
|
|
if let Ok(ident) = input.step(|c| {
|
|
c.ident()
|
|
.filter(|(_, c)| c.eof() || punct(',')(*c).is_some())
|
|
.ok_or_else(|| syn::Error::new(c.span(), "expected `ident(,|eof)`"))
|
|
}) {
|
|
Ok(Self::Ident(ident))
|
|
} else {
|
|
input.step(|c| {
|
|
take_until1(
|
|
alt([
|
|
&mut seq([
|
|
&mut path_sep,
|
|
&mut balanced_pair(punct('<'), punct('>')),
|
|
]),
|
|
&mut seq([
|
|
&mut balanced_pair(punct('<'), punct('>')),
|
|
&mut path_sep,
|
|
]),
|
|
&mut balanced_pair(punct('|'), punct('|')),
|
|
&mut token_tree,
|
|
]),
|
|
punct(','),
|
|
)(*c)
|
|
.map(|(stream, cursor)| (Self::Other(stream), cursor))
|
|
.ok_or_else(|| syn::Error::new(c.span(), "failed to parse expression"))
|
|
})
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l PartialEq<syn::Ident> for Expr {
|
|
fn eq(&self, other: &syn::Ident) -> bool {
|
|
self.ident().is_some_and(|i| i == other)
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
impl ToTokens for Expr {
|
|
fn to_tokens(&self, tokens: &mut TokenStream) {
|
|
match self {
|
|
Self::Ident(ident) => ident.to_tokens(tokens),
|
|
Self::Other(other) => other.to_tokens(tokens),
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Result of parsing.
|
|
type ParsingResult<'a> = Option<(TokenStream, Cursor<'a>)>;
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to parse a [`token::PathSep`].
|
|
///
|
|
/// [`token::PathSep`]: struct@syn::token::PathSep
|
|
pub fn path_sep(c: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> {
|
|
seq([
|
|
&mut punct_with_spacing(':', Spacing::Joint),
|
|
&mut punct(':'),
|
|
])(c)
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to parse a [`punct`] with [`Spacing`].
|
|
pub fn punct_with_spacing(
|
|
p: char,
|
|
spacing: Spacing,
|
|
)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> {
|
|
move |c| {
|
|
c.punct().and_then(|(punct, c)| {
|
|
(punct.as_char() == p && punct.spacing() == spacing)
|
|
.then(|| (punct.into_token_stream(), c))
|
|
})
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to parse a [`Punct`].
|
|
///
|
|
/// [`Punct`]: proc_macro2::Punct
|
|
pub fn punct(p: char)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> {
|
|
move |c| {
|
|
c.punct().and_then(|(punct, c)| {
|
|
(punct.as_char() == p).then(|| (punct.into_token_stream(), c))
|
|
})
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to parse any [`TokenTree`].
|
|
///
|
|
/// [`TokenTree`]: proc_macro2::TokenTree
|
|
pub fn token_tree(c: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> {
|
|
c.token_tree().map(|(tt, c)| (tt.into_token_stream(), c))
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Parses until balanced amount of `open` and `close` or eof.
|
|
///
|
|
/// [`Cursor`] should be pointing **right after** the first `open`ing.
|
|
pub fn balanced_pair(
|
|
mut open: imp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>,
|
|
mut close: imp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>,
|
|
)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> {
|
|
move |c| {
|
|
let (mut out, mut c) = open(c)?;
|
|
let mut count = 1;
|
|
|
|
while count != 0 {
|
|
let (stream, cursor) = if let Some(closing) = close(c) {
|
|
count -= 1;
|
|
closing
|
|
} else if let Some(opening) = open(c) {
|
|
count += 1;
|
|
opening
|
|
} else {
|
|
let (tt, c) = c.token_tree()?;
|
|
(tt.into_token_stream(), c)
|
|
};
|
|
out.extend(stream);
|
|
c = cursor;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
Some((out, c))
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to execute the provided sequence of `parsers`.
|
|
pub fn seq<const N: usize>(
|
|
mut parsers: [&mut dyn F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>; N],
|
|
)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> + '_ {
|
|
move |c| {
|
|
parsers.iter_mut().try_fold(
|
|
(TokenStream::new(), c),
|
|
|(mut out, mut c), parser| {
|
|
let (stream, cursor) = parser(c)?;
|
|
out.extend(stream);
|
|
c = cursor;
|
|
Some((out, c))
|
|
},
|
|
)
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Tries to execute the first successful parser.
|
|
pub fn alt<const N: usize>(
|
|
mut parsers: [&mut dyn F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>; N],
|
|
)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_> + '_ {
|
|
move |c| parsers.iter_mut().find_map(|parser| parser(c))
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/// Parses with `basic` while `until` fails. Returns [`None`] in case
|
|
/// `until` succeeded initially or `basic` never succeeded. Doesn't consume
|
|
/// tokens parsed by `until`.
|
|
pub fn take_until1<P, U>(
|
|
mut parser: P,
|
|
mut until: U,
|
|
) -> impl F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>
|
|
where
|
|
P: F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>,
|
|
U: FnMut(Cursor<'_>) -> ParsingResult<'_>,
|
|
{
|
|
move |mut cursor| {
|
|
let mut out = TokenStream::new();
|
|
let mut parsed = false;
|
|
|
|
loop {
|
|
if cursor.eof() || until(cursor).is_some() {
|
|
return parsed.then_some((out, cursor));
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
let (stream, c) = parser(cursor)?;
|
|
out.extend(stream);
|
|
cursor = c;
|
|
parsed = true;
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
}
